|
|
|
@@ -12,7 +12,7 @@ |
|
|
|
* [编写测试类](#编写测试类)
|
|
|
|
* [配置文件详解](#配置文件详解)
|
|
|
|
* [数据库连接参数](#数据库连接参数)
|
|
|
|
* [连接池数据基本参数](#连接池数据基本参数)
|
|
|
|
* [连接池基本参数](#连接池基本参数)
|
|
|
|
* [连接存活参数](#连接存活参数)
|
|
|
|
* [连接检查参数](#连接检查参数)
|
|
|
|
* [缓存语句](#缓存语句)
|
|
|
|
@@ -52,7 +52,7 @@ |
|
|
|
|
|
|
|
# 简介
|
|
|
|
|
|
|
|
`DBCP`用于创建和管理连接,利用“池”的方式复用连接减少资源开销。目前,`tomcat`自带的连接池就是`DBCP`,Spring开发组也推荐使用`DBCP`。
|
|
|
|
`DBCP`用于创建和管理连接,利用“池”的方式复用连接减少资源开销,和其他连接池一样,也具有连接数控制、连接可靠性测试、连接泄露控制、缓存语句等功能。目前,`tomcat`自带的连接池就是`DBCP`,Spring开发组也推荐使用`DBCP`。
|
|
|
|
|
|
|
|
`DBCP`除了我们熟知的使用方式外,还支持通过`JNDI`获取数据源,并支持获取`JTA`或`XA`事务中用于`2PC`(两阶段提交)的连接对象,本文也将以例子说明。
|
|
|
|
|
|
|
|
@@ -227,7 +227,7 @@ username=root |
|
|
|
password=root
|
|
|
|
```
|
|
|
|
|
|
|
|
## 连接池数据基本参数
|
|
|
|
## 连接池基本参数
|
|
|
|
这几个参数都比较常用,具体设置多少需根据项目调整。
|
|
|
|
|
|
|
|
```properties
|
|
|
|
|